The Informatics Engineering Study Program, Faculty of Science and Technology, Universitas Prima Indonesia (UNPRI) held an impactful public lecture titled "Cryptography: Where Mathematics Serves as Cyberspace's Bodyguard" on Wednesday, January 29, 2026. The event, held at the UNPRI Campus Mini Hall, Medan, featured Dr. Mohammad Andri Budiman, a renowned expert from the University of North Sumatra, as the keynote speaker. He addressed hundreds of students on how cryptography has evolved into the cornerstone of digital confidentiality and global systemic trust.
During the session, Dr. Budiman emphasized that understanding the mathematical building blocks of cryptography is essential for building secure digital infrastructures. He highlighted the CIAN principles (Confidentiality, Integrity, Availability, and Non-repudiation) as the gold standard for future developers. The lecture also covered practical applications of symmetric and asymmetric encryption in modern banking, digital communication, and personal data protection, aligning with UNPRI's commitment to SDGs 4 and SDGs 9.
"Cryptography is not just a complex mathematical formula, but a 'bodyguard' that ensures data integrity in cyberspace. Mastering CIAN principles is the first step for students to design secure, ethical, and reliable digital systems amidst increasingly complex cyber threats," he asserted.
